Advantages:
- Excellent Corrosion Resistance: PFA exhibits outstanding chemical stability, resisting nearly all
corrosive substances, including strong acids, alkalis, and organic
solvents.
- Exceptional High-Temperature Resistance: PFA remains stable across a temperature range of -200°C to 260°C,
making it suitable for harsh high-temperature environments.
- Superior Transparency: PFA offers better transparency than PTFE, enabling visual
inspection and fluid observation.
- Smooth Surface and Low Friction Coefficient: PFA has excellent non-stick and self-lubricating properties,
reducing friction and preventing debris adhesion.
- Excellent Electrical Insulation: PFA is an ideal high-frequency insulating material due to its
superior electrical insulation properties.
- Aging and Weather Resistance: PFA is stable in atmospheric conditions, with strong anti-aging
capabilities, suitable for outdoor and extreme applications.
- Strong Processability: PFA has good melt flow characteristics, suitable for injection
molding, extrusion, and various processing methods.
- Biocompatibility: Due to its physiological inertness, PFA can be used in
pharmaceuticals, medical devices, and the food industry, meeting
FDA and other international standards.
- Permeation Resistance: PFA has low permeability, offering excellent performance in gas
barriers and liquid sealing.
Applications:
PFA is widely applied as a corrosion-resistant, high-temperature,
and insulating material across high-tech, chemical, pharmaceutical,
food, semiconductor, electronics, and electrical fields, making it
an essential product in these industries. Examples include:
- Chemical Industry: PFA is used in pipes, valves, and linings for corrosion-resistant
equipment in highly demanding chemical environments.
- Semiconductor and Electronics: It is used in producing high-purity chemical containers, pumps,
and tubing, ensuring contaminant-free conditions.
- Medical and Pharmaceutical: With its high purity and biocompatibility, PFA is used in medical
devices, laboratory equipment, and drug packaging.
- Food Industry: PFA meets food contact material standards, making it suitable for
food processing equipment, conveyor belts, and packaging films.
- Aerospace and Defense: PFA’s superior properties are leveraged in aerospace and defense
for manufacturing high-temperature and corrosion-resistant
components.
- Electrical and Insulation Applications: PFA is used in high-frequency cables and insulating films,
providing excellent electrical insulation and high-temperature
performance.

Q2: How does PFA compare to PTFE in injection molded parts?
A: While both PFA and PTFE offer excellent chemical resistance, PFA
is better suited for injection molding due to its higher melt flow
and processing flexibility. This makes it ideal for complex part
designs that are difficult to achieve with PTFE.
